Baiyuerius cuii -species group
Diagnosis. Males of cuii- species group can be identified by the following combination of characters: 1) patella with two apophyses ( Figs 3C View FIGURE 3 , 5C View FIGURE 5 ); 2) process of dorsal margin of conductor without basal stalk and not serrated ( Figs 3B View FIGURE 3 , 5B View FIGURE 5 ); 3) distal end of the process laterally pointed ( Figs 3B View FIGURE 3 , 5B View FIGURE 5 ).
Distribution. China (Hubei Province, Sichuan Province and Yunnan Province).
Species included. Two species are included in this group: B. cuii sp. nov. and B. jiquanyui sp. nov.
